Do you need a passport to go to Christmas Island?

Normal Australian Customs and Immigration procedures apply when entry is made from outside Australia. Passports and visas are not required when travelling from the Australian mainland. Christmas Island is a territory of Australia.

Do I need a car on Christmas Island?

Covering a total area of 135 square kilometers (of which 63% is Covered by incredible flora and fauna in Christmas Island National Park), visitors will need to hire a vehicle in order to get around Christmas Island. There is no public transport, and only 1 taxi firm available.

What is the best time to visit Christmas Island?

The best time to visit Christmas Island is from July to October, since it is the least rainy and the sunniest period of the year; in particular, the months of August and September stand out as the driest.

Is Christmas Island part of Singapore?

The sovereignty of Christmas Island was transferred from Singapore (then a Crown colony of the United Kingdom) to the Commonwealth of Australia on 1 October 1958 under the Transfer to Australia Order in Council, 1958.

Does Christmas Island have Internet?

Internet access on Christmas Island is provided by satellite. There is an internet cafe at the Visitor Information Centre, or you can pick up a prepaid voucher for the wifi hotspots located in township areas. Many hotels and self-contained units also offer internet access to guests.

Can you take food to Christmas Island?

Bringing food to Christmas Island is quite an easy process. You can check in a Styrofoam box which are easy to get from grocery stores and farmers markets. You can bring pretty much anything except for prawns. Please ENSURE you keep a receipt of your purchases to show customs upon declaration.

Where is Christmas Island Airport XCH located?

Christmas Island International Airport ( IATA: XCH, ICAO: YPXM) is an airport located on Christmas Island, a territory of Australia in the Indian Ocean.

How many passengers did Christmas Island International Airport serve in 2017-2018?

Christmas Island International Airport served 26,723 revenue passengers during financial year 2017-2018. Fees and charges at the airport are set by the Commonwealth of Australia and are considerably higher than airports, especially for small aircraft.

Which airlines fly to Christmas Island?

Historically airlines such as Indonesia AirAsia, Malaysia Airlines and SilkAir travelled to the island. Tourist attractions such as the migration of the Christmas Island red crab and the island’s Christmas Island Resort have caused spikes in traffic levels.
